The median salary for Data Analyst roles in Texas is $67,500 per year. Most pay falls between $56,875 (25th percentile) and $87,125 (75th percentile), with the broader 10th–90th percentile band running from $55,000 to $104,150.
These figures are computed live from 27 active Data Analyst roles in Texas on JobsRadar, of which 9 (33.3%) publish a salary range. Pay is normalized to annualized USD so roles can be compared on equal terms; the highest-paying roles listed above show their original posted currency. Numbers refresh every few hours as new roles are posted and older ones close.
Employers currently hiring well-paid Data Analyst roles in Texas include Conga, Inspire11, Burson and CharterUP.
Salary transparency varies by employer and region, so the disclosing share above reflects only roles that publish pay — not every open position. Use it as a directional benchmark rather than an exact offer.
